Sd Backyard article - West Coast Recruitment
and Major League Prospects - 2009
Native San Diegan and former Major League All-Star,
Ed Herrmann has formally joined the Seminara Sports of New York as
Director of West Coast Recruitment. Seminara Sports Agency (www.seminarasports.com)
is committed to helping student-athletes achieve their professional
and personal goals in an honorable and value-driven way. Their
philosophy on advisement at the collegiate level is different from
other agencies in the business. Unlike many of their counterparts,
Seminara Sports develops a relationship with the coaching staff
first. They do not directly solicit amateur athletes without first
obtaining the approval of the coaching staff and/or parents of the
student-athlete.
The background of the professionals at Seminara Sports includes law,
medicine, marketing and professional baseball.

Union Tribune
Focus on Poway
POWAY – Ed Herrmann is one
of the lucky few. He made it to the big time.
Herrmann, a longtime Poway resident, is a retired professional
baseball player. He played for the former Milwaukee Braves, the New
York Yankees, the Chicago White Sox, the California Angels, the
Houston Astros and the Montreal Expos. His career spanned 15 years,
including 12 in the majors
